SailPoint deeply values the well-being of crew. When people are healthy and supported, they are empowered to do their most innovative and impactful work. This approach is centered on offering accessible, confidential, and effective resources.
A key element of SailPoint’s commitment to fostering employee wellbeing is the Employee Assistance Program (EAP), which provides free, confidential counseling sessions for employees and their families to help navigate life's challenges.
Beyond the EAP, Care Coaches are available to provide personalized guidance and support for a variety of needs, from stress management to personal finance and more. By providing these direct and personalized support systems, our crew are empowered to bring their best selves to work every day.

Remote or Hybrid Flexibility: Flexible remote and hybrid options with an outcomes-over-hours ethos give employees control over where and when they work. This setup is described as enabling better day-to-day balance across many teams.
-
Time Off Access: Flexible or unlimited PTO, generous holidays, and sick leave are encouraged and easy to use. These practices support recovery time and make disconnecting more practical.
-
Supportive Culture: A people-first culture with trust, autonomy, and supportive managers reduces micromanagement and helps maintain boundaries. Mental health resources like EAP and care coaches further reinforce wellbeing.
